Transaction 7638863420554bcec8412d1e3b51ac1b5ef756102403ec3ac4b54e19a53d62e7
1 Input
1 Output
-
7638863420554bcec8412d1e3b51ac1b5ef756102403ec3ac4b54e19a53d62e7:0
- value
- 47649966
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d93825c8a596698271b5e7c49e07c7546b2b2f9
- address
- bc1q0kfcyhy2t9nfsfcmte7yncruw4rt9vhefmszrf